BIOGRAPHY
House De’ Mici is recognised as one of Serenno’s Great Houses. Despite being the current heiress to her family’s titles, Sybella is far more interested in reclaiming their ancestral honour amongst the Jedi given the fact the De’ Mici family were especially well known for their hereditary affinity with the force; records showed that a number of Jedi had been sired amongst their bloodline, with many going on to serve as faithful peacekeepers. Should one of their offspring show potential, it was almost considered customary to offer that child for service amongst the Order.
Yet despite their best intentions, shame fell upon the family. During the Clone Wars (around 19BBY), one of their kin (a prominent Jedi knight) fell to the dark side and allied themselves with Count Dooku; much to the chagrin of their relatives, the ancestor became one of Dooku’s many acolytes. According to rumours, this was not the first Demici to fall and rather than risk further indignity, the relations with the Jedi were severed. Ironically, in separating themselves, House Demici survived what would become known as the great purge; they endured under the Empire long enough to witness the rise of New Republic. When the Jedi Order began its revival, members of the Demici were still hesitant to reinstate their age-old allegiance. They feared history would repeat itself and were concerned with the prospect of producing another potential dark sider.
Yet nothing could deter young Sybella, she had learnt of her family’s legacy from an early age and she desired more than anything to restore it to its former glory. When she came of age, Sybella made her petition and joined the Jedi Order, becoming a Jedi Knight shortly after completing her trials. Shortly after, the Sith Empire would regain control of Serenno, essentially making Sybella an exile.
PERSONALITY
As expected, Sybella was raised to be a dignified individual. Stoic in the face of danger, the young Jedi is usually quite calm and collected, charging into battle without a moment of hesitation. She is selfless and seeks to defend those who otherwise cannot protect themselves. Sybella also holds the Jedi Order in great esteem and believes strongly in its code.
Inwardly, however, the Serennian heiress is her own worse critic. Though she cherishes her family’s legacy, she also burdens herself with doubt; the shame of her ancestor is especially potent. Though she can not be certain, she feels there are those who look down on her because of her troubling lineage; her greatest fear is becoming like her disgraced kin, especially as Sybella shares some of their less-than-desirable traits. The exile from her homeworld of Serenno also causes the young noble to feel homesick. She wishes she could return but it would mean having to choose between her oath as a Jedi and her duty as apparent heir to the Demici house.
SKILLS
Strong in the force, Sybella frequently experiences visions; she has had these visions since her adolescence and meditates often in order to ponder their potential meanings. Admittedly, some are more difficult to interpret than others and the visions can sometimes be unreliable. Nevertheless, the young Serennian often journals about her experiences during these visions, hoping one day to become more proficient. It should be noted that as a knight, her use of telekinesis is rather adept, especially during combat. Sybella trains in a more offensive style and utilises two lightsabers; she will charge her enemy and seek to overwhelm them with a barge of deliberate blows. As expected, she is also rather agile, using speed to keep her opponents on the back foot.
As it stands, the knight has gone on to develop an impressive array of Force abilities, including (but not limited to) plant surge, animal friendship as well as pyrokinesis - interestingly enough, she also shares this ability with a relative of hers, Kalique Demici, who is a direct cousin. Sybella has also started to experiment with the art of cloaking herself, both visually and in the Force.
